Larry Elder is a libertarian, but his opinions aren't what's important about this book. What's important is the way he digs down to the source of misinformation that's been strewn about. Many of the things commonly believed in America are based on studies carefully constructed to mislead the public. Mr. Elder presents the way data has been skewed by the special interests, blowing it out of the water for those who have minds open enough to reevaluate the "common knowledge" that's been spewed by the media. Give it a read, then argue with it if you can.
